Output 2dbf85f61afe63fc3e1455901bf0a99ae5c75df55daafbca775d2019c8e3763f:57

value
264078
script pubkey
OP_0 OP_PUSHBYTES_32 77aa7643a1a8d042acd41a2c19cf95e2800e49342ef9acaec26b5e6e8acaa70f
address
bc1qw748vsap4rgy9tx5rgkpnnu4u2qqujf59mu6etkzdd0xazk25u8s7xy592
transaction
2dbf85f61afe63fc3e1455901bf0a99ae5c75df55daafbca775d2019c8e3763f
confirmations
662
spent
true